To define
Tab Slide Placement settings
- Click the Smart Shape Tool . The Smart Shape
menu appears.
- Choose Smart Shape Placement from the Smart
Shape menu. The Smart Shape Placement dialog box appears.
- Choose Tab Slide from the Smart Shape type
drop down list
in the dialog box.
- Drag the tab slide end point vertically and
horizontally until the tab slide attaches to the notes the way you want
it to attach to notes of that type in the score. Instead of using
the mouse, you can enter values into the text boxes using the measurement
unit you’ve selected.
- Drag the other end-point of the tab slide to
adjust it.
- Click Reset at any time to return the tab slide
to Finale’s built-in settings.
- Click OK (or press enter)
when you’re ready to save the new settings. Or click Cancel to
cancel any changes you made to the settings.
Note: All tab slides
that you create from now on will use the Tab Slide Placement settings.
The settings also apply to tab slide end points that haven’t been manually
adjusted in all existing tab slides.
